(a) This section applies to each individual or group health insurance policy or contract that is: (1) delivered or issued for delivery in the State by an insurer or nonprofit health service plan; and (2) issued, renewed, amended, or reissued on or after October 1, 1993. (b) An insurer or nonprofit health service plan may not impose a time limit on the receipt of services covered under a policy or contract subject to this section that are provided during the policy or contract period by a physical therapist licensed under the Health Occupations Article. (c) This section does not prohibit an insurer or nonprofit health service plan from imposing a limit on the number of visits with a licensed physical therapist that are allowed under a policy or contract.
